Address 299.99115816 DOGE

DPcYbUPRkHPyuCkgsSZiMVCB5dbdTPFUji

Confirmed

Total Received299.99115816 DOGE
Total Sent0 DOGE
Final Balance299.99115816 DOGE
No. Transactions1

Transactions